Concrete Foundation Sealing in Montgomery, AL
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ized protective coatings to the exterior surfaces of a property's foundation. This process helps prevent water infiltration, reduce moisture-related damage, and extend the lifespan of the foundation. Projects typically include sealing basement walls, crawl space foundations, or other exposed concrete surfaces around residential properties,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or humidity. Homeowners often seek this service to safeguard their investment, improve energy efficiency, and maintain the structural integrity of their homes.
Before requesting concrete foundation sealing, property owners usually want to understand the condition of their existing foundation surface and whether any cracks or damage exist that may require additional repairs. It’s also helpful to consider the type of sealant used, the best application method for the specific foundation material, and how often resealing might be necessary to maintain protection. Proper sealing can be a key step in preventing costly repairs caused by water damage and ensuring the foundation remains durable over time.

Common Concrete Foundation Sealing Jobs
Basement Foundations - sealing prevents water intrusion and reduces moisture buildup.
Driveway and Patio Slabs - sealing helps protect against cracks and surface deterioration.
Garage Floors - sealing provides a protective barrier against stains and wear.
Commercial Concrete Structures - sealing extends the lifespan of large-scale concrete surfaces.
Retaining Walls - sealing guards against water damage and soil erosion.
Crawl Space Foundations - sealing helps control humidity and prevent mold growth.
Concrete Foundation Sealing Questions
What is concrete foundation sealing? It involves applying a protective coating to prevent moisture and water from penetrating the foundation, helping to maintain its integrity.
Why should homeowners consider foundation sealing? Sealing can reduce the risk of cracks, water damage, and basement moisture issues, protecting the property's value.
What types of projects typically require foundation sealing? Sealing is often recommended for homes with basement foundations, crawl spaces, or areas prone to water infiltration.
How does foundation sealing benefit property owners? It enhances durability, minimizes maintenance needs, and helps preserve the structure's stability over time.
